Queue and Theming:
- The queue for Expedition Everest is designed to immerse you in the world of the Himalayan mountains. As you progress through the line, you'll encounter ancient ruins and artifacts, creating a sense of adventure and anticipation.
Ride Experience:
1. Boarding: You'll board specially-designed vehicles that resemble a train on an expedition through the mountains. Each row of seats can accommodate four passengers.
2. Ascent: The ride begins with a smooth climb up the snowy slopes of Mount Everest. During this ascent, you'll enjoy beautiful views of the surrounding scenery and the towering mountain in the distance.
3. Expedition Through Caves: As you enter a series of caves, the coaster takes unexpected turns and twists. You'll pass by ancient ruins and encounter animatronic yeti creatures that add to the thrilling experience.
4. Sudden Drops and Turns: Expedition Everest features several steep drops and sharp turns that create a sense of excitement and uncertainty. Some of these drops are quite significant and provide a stomach-dropping sensation.
5. Reverse Ride: In the middle of the ride, the coaster briefly reverses direction, creating an unexpected twist.
6. Yeti Encounter: The final part of the ride brings you face-to-face with a massive audio-animatronic yeti. This encounter can be intense, especially for younger visitors, but it adds to the overall thrill of the ride.
7. Descent and Conclusion: After the yeti encounter, the coaster descends rapidly, providing another rush of excitement before the ride concludes back at the station.
Overall, Expedition Everest is an exhilarating roller coaster that offers a unique and immersive experience with unexpected twists, turns, and drops. The combination of intricate theming, thrilling ride elements, and special effects makes it a popular attraction for adults and thrill-seeking guests.
